Starting your kitchen career is exciting, but landing that first commis chef role requires a CV that demonstrates genuine commitment to the profession. As the entry-level position in the professional kitchen brigade, the commis chef works under the supervision of a chef de partie, learning section skills, mastering mise en place, and developing the speed, consistency, and discipline that professional kitchens demand. According to Glassdoor, the average commis chef salary sits at £22,624, while CV-Library reports a range of £20,000 to £25,000. Indeed and Chef Selection place the average at £22,550, with RetailJobs data suggesting experienced commis chefs can earn up to £38,000 in specialist or London-based roles. For most entry-level positions, expect a starting salary between £19,000 and £25,000 with rapid progression possible for those who demonstrate talent and commitment.

The commis chef role is the launching pad for a kitchen career. The typical progression runs from Kitchen Porter through Commis Chef, Demi CDP, Chef de Partie, and then Sous Chef. With dedication and talent, fast-track progression to CDP is possible within 18 to 24 months at supportive venues. Focus on learning every section, gaining certifications, and building a portfolio of skills. Many of the UK's top head chefs and executive chefs began their careers as commis chefs — the key is consistent development and seeking out kitchens that invest in training.
The UK chef shortage creates genuine opportunity for committed commis chefs. Employers are increasingly investing in apprenticeship programmes, with major groups like Compass, Sodexo, and hotel chains offering structured development pathways. Starting salaries range from £19,000 to £25,000, with London and the South East at the higher end. Many venues offer additional benefits including meals on duty, uniform provision, and training budgets. The hospitality industry actively promotes internal progression, making the commis chef role one of the most accessible entry points to a rewarding long-term career.
